As 2025 unfolds, sealing head screws are redefining reliability for demanding assemblies. The latest designs integrate a seal or gasket at the head, delivering high IP ratings without extra installation steps. Improved thread geometry reduces galling and maintains a firm seal under vibration, while coatings and corrosion-resistant materials extend service life in harsh environments. When paired with automation-friendly tolerances and versatile drive options, these screws streamline assembly lines and reduce field failures in high-temperature or dynamic applications.
